Exercise Can Help You Cope With Your Bad Memories
By admin on Jul 31, 2009 in Health and Fitness
Realage is backing up a claim by Outdoor Fitness magazine that walking can help you cope with bad memories.
As you exercise your body can help you get rid of bad memories that are stored up in your mind.
I don't think they mean you'll never remember the bad stuff, but exercise helps you cope better. It clears your thoughts in a lot of good ways.
Outdoor exercise such as walking is recommended because it will make us feel good to get outside and get moving.
